    I am a travel nurse and tend to visit many nail salons. I can honestly say I have never seen a mail place even close to as filthy as this one. Everything is covered in dust and grime. They don't clean anything between uses either. There was a person getting a manicure next to me as I waited for mine, and the lady took the bowl that the customers nails were soaking in, emptied the bowl, and just filled it up with water for me to put my hands into to soak. no cleaning, no rinsing, nothing. You feel dirty just sitting there. 100% do not recommend. ETA: Just woke up the day after my "manicure"- I looked at my nails in the bathroom and the color was COMPLETELY different. I had a color applied that was called 'Rose Dust' and it was a purple color. This morning it is literally tan- as in skin tone. The edges of the nail are purplish, reminiscent of the color it was yesterday. I have attached a picture to explain what I mean. I don't even want to go back to complain because they will just want to give me another manicure which I have zero interest in. Trust me when I say RUN FROM THIS PLACE!!!!
